Engine & tranny mounts 200 1979

Hi All, I am now facing the task of replacing engine and tranny mounts. I am a novice and I am thinking I am in over my head. I am not sure if I can do this alone. Should I try it myself? I found a garage that will install the 2 engine mounts, and the tranny mount for $120, I supply the parts. What should I do? Unfortunetly, money is an issue , if not I wouldn't be considering doing it myself. Although, I do enjoy the satifaction of fixing my brick, I don't want to kill myself, or screw my wagon up. Any tips on parts? installation? or life in general? Thanks in advance..Franco79 245dl 215k
